wilga
English
Noun
wilga (plural wilgas)
- Geijera parviflora, a small tree or bush found in inland parts of eastern Australia, and grown elsewhere for its drought tolerance and its graceful willow-like weeping form.
Synonyms
- dogwood
- sheepbush
